An Artificial Vertical Garden is a decorative wall feature that mimics the look of a living garden, but uses artificial plants and foliage instead. Here are some benefits and uses of Artificial Vertical Gardens:
Benefits:
- Low Maintenance: No watering, pruning, or fertilizing required.
- Year-Round Greenery: Maintains a lush appearance 365 days a year.
- Space-Saving: Ideal for small spaces, indoors or outdoors.
- Air Purification: Some artificial plants are designed to purify the air.
- Customizable: Can be tailored to fit any space or design style.
